A method of understanding and processing isar lmage based on time-frequency analysis
|
Abstract:
The basic and major difficulty in Automatic Target Recognition(ATR) based on the Inverse Synthetic Aperture Radar (ISAR) image is to automatically understand the ISAR images. A method of understanding and processing ISAR image is presented, which is based on the time-frequency analysis algorithm - improved Adaptive Guassian Representation(AGR). By parameterizing the point-scattering and dispersive-scattering mechanisms exiting in the target ISAR image, the dispersive-scattering effect is removed to improve the image quality, and extract features of scattering centers on the target which is useful to ATR. The efficiency and feasibility of the method is confirmed by the test based on the real data of airplane.
